Output 91166584029a9287b7529718fbbffcb7dffb8722aa55b156ade5718fc853f91a:22

value
64233405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3d6cc9d458d3930fc26547bdd4d9457d8195782 OP_EQUAL
address
3PvKSg2vRBXPjVJf5Hcd6cS2RVgjQVXv72
transaction
91166584029a9287b7529718fbbffcb7dffb8722aa55b156ade5718fc853f91a
spent
true